首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用ejs或页眉和页脚模板进行github页面的静态托管?

使用ejs或页眉和页脚模板进行GitHub页面的静态托管,可以通过以下步骤实现:

  1. 首先,确保你已经在GitHub上创建了一个仓库,用于托管你的静态页面。
  2. 在本地创建一个文件夹,用于存放你的项目文件。
  3. 在该文件夹中,创建一个名为index.ejs的文件,作为你的页面模板。
  4. index.ejs文件中,使用ejs语法编写你的页面内容,包括页眉和页脚的模板部分。
  5. 在同级目录下创建一个名为header.ejs的文件,用于存放页眉的模板内容。
  6. header.ejs文件中,编写你的页眉内容。
  7. 同样,在同级目录下创建一个名为footer.ejs的文件,用于存放页脚的模板内容。
  8. footer.ejs文件中,编写你的页脚内容。
  9. 在本地的项目文件夹中,创建一个名为index.html的文件,用于生成最终的静态页面。
  10. index.html文件中,使用ejs的include语法引入页眉和页脚的模板文件,将其插入到页面中。
  11. 使用ejs的命令行工具或相关插件,将index.ejs文件编译为index.html文件。
  12. 将生成的index.html文件和其他相关的静态资源(如CSS、JavaScript文件等)一起提交到GitHub仓库中。
  13. 在GitHub仓库的设置中,将仓库的默认分支设置为gh-pages,以便GitHub将该分支作为静态页面的托管分支。
  14. 等待GitHub完成页面的构建和托管过程,你的静态页面就可以通过GitHub Pages访问了。

使用ejs或页眉和页脚模板进行GitHub页面的静态托管的优势是可以实现页面内容的模块化和复用,提高开发效率和维护性。此外,通过GitHub Pages进行静态页面托管还具有免费、稳定、可靠的特点。

推荐的腾讯云相关产品:腾讯云对象存储(COS)。

腾讯云对象存储(COS)是一种安全、高可用、低成本的云端对象存储服务,适用于存储和处理任意类型的文件,包括静态网页文件。你可以将生成的静态页面文件上传到腾讯云对象存储(COS)中,并通过腾讯云的CDN加速服务,实现快速访问和分发。

了解更多关于腾讯云对象存储(COS)的信息,请访问:腾讯云对象存储(COS)产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券